Big and bold, oscillating surfaces make themselves at home.

Fluting has been around for centuries and continues to deliver dimension, texture and rhythm to spaces of all kinds. Ditto for ribbed and channeled details. At this year’s St. George Parade of Homes, a wave of designers created striking statements with exaggerated scale and clever execution of these rippling surfaces. Take a moment to peruse this fabulous examples.

1. Richly plastered, large-scale fluting delivers daring dimension and intriguing shadows to an engaging dining space.

Design by Becki Owens Design/Split Rock Custom Homes

2. A deep apron of vertical ribbing anchors a shallow fireplace mantel.

Design by Kami Olmstead Design/K.H. Traveller Custom Homes. 

3. Vertical fluting details a traditional bathroom’s painted vanity.

Design by Juniper Design Collective/Jensen+Sons Construction. 

4. Robust ribbing clads a dramatic half wall for a richly outfitted shower.

Design by Kami Olmstead Design/K.H. Traveller Custom Homes. 

5. Taupe plaster teams with oversized fluting on a chic bedroom wall.

Design by Ember/Cedar Point Homes.
